What does a Logistical Operations Manager do?

A Logistical Operations Manager oversees the planning, coordination, and execution of a company's supply chain and distribution processes. They ensure that goods are transported efficiently from suppliers to customers, manage inventory levels, and optimize logistics operations to reduce costs and improve service quality. This role often involves collaborating with vendors, negotiating contracts, and implementing strategies to enhance productivity and customer satisfaction.

What are the 7 C's of logistics?

The 7 C's of logistics are a framework for effective supply chain management, including Customer service, Cost, Coordination, Communication, Control, Convenience, and Continuity. As a Logistical Operations Manager, understanding these principles helps optimize operations, improve service levels, and reduce costs within the supply chain environment.

How does a Logistical Operations Manager typically collaborate with other departments within a company?

A Logistical Operations Manager regularly works with various departments such as procurement, sales, and customer service to ensure smooth and efficient supply chain operations. They coordinate with procurement to manage inventory levels, collaborate with sales teams to align logistics capabilities with customer demands, and communicate with customer service to resolve delivery issues swiftly. This cross-functional teamwork is essential for meeting deadlines, optimizing costs, and maintaining high customer satisfaction.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Logistical Operations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Logistical Operations Manager, you need expertise in supply chain management, inventory control, and logistics planning, often supported by a degree in business, logistics, or a related field. Familiarity with en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ems, warehouse management software, and relevant certifications like APICS or Six Sigma is highly valuable. Strong leadership, problem-solving, and effective communication skills help you coordinate teams and adapt to changing demands. These abilities are essential for ensuring efficient, cost-effective operations and meeting organizational goals in a dynamic environment.
